HOST: Our topic today is the Advanced Certificate in Docker Containerization for Efficient DevOps. Can you tell us a little bit about this course and what students can expect to learn?
GUEST: Absolutely! This course is designed to bridge the gap between development and operations by teaching students the fundamentals of Docker containerization and how to apply it in real-world scenarios. We cover everything from deploying, managing, and scaling containerized applications to automating workflows, optimizing resources, and ensuring high availability.
